Why to visit Rajwada Palace

Rajwada is a majestic and historical palace in the city of Indore that was built by the Holkars more than 200 years ago and is located near the famed Kajuri Market. It's a seven-story edifice near the Chhatris that serves as a fine illustration of regal splendour. The Rajwada palace, which is nestled between the bustling alleys of the Kajuri Bazar and confronts the city's main plaza, also faces a well-kept garden with a statue of Queen Ahilya Bai, an artificial waterfall, and other lovely fountains. Even after all these years, the palace remains one of Indore's most popular tourist attractions and one of the city's oldest landmarks.
